About This Job

The main purpose of this job is to provide servicing and processing for time sensitive, high risk transactions for internal Private Client Advisors.

Essential Functions

  • Build and maintain relationships with Private Client Advisors and ensure a timely, complete and accurate processing of IRA transactions

  • Deliver support and resolutions that meet goals of the advisors

  • Work closely with and provide customer service for Private Client Administrators to facilitate all distributions related to the IRA product offering

  • Receive notification from the Private Client Administrators along with the information needed to facilitate IRA distributions; process normal and premature distributions, distributions due to death, internal transfer distributions, and transfers to an outside custodian

  • Process state and federal withholding; ensure all compliance requirements have been met and all processing and coding is complete, timely, and accurate

  • Ensure appropriate controls are in place for all processes related to the IRA product offering; responsible for identifying accounts with clients reaching their required minimum distribution

  • Collaborate with the Private Client Advisors to mail Required Minimum Distribution (RMD) letters to the clients identified and reviewing reports to review accounts that have not satisfied their RMD; gather missing account information such as date of birth, date of death, and beneficiaries.

  • Work closely with other members of the team to assist/backup during high volumes or absence

  • Perform other duties as assigned
